func CheckPassword

func CheckPassword(pw string, ignore bool) bool

CheckPassword if ignore is false will use remote site to validate password. ignore should be true for things like the old password when chaning passwords (so you can upgrade a password).

Documented: https://haveibeenpwned.com/API/v2#PwnedPasswords GET https://api.pwnedpasswords.com/range/{first 5 hash chars}

Examlple Call:

if CheckPassword(newPhrase, isOldPassword) == false {
	Fatalf(3, "Password is a known to be leaked (pwned) password - you will need to use a different password\n")
}

func HandleDevUnPwLogin

func HandleDevUnPwLogin(www http.ResponseWriter, req *http.Request)

HandleDevUnPwLogin is a login handler for dev-un-pw-acct types. It checks the username/password and if the hashed password matches then success is achieved. This type of an account will not use 2fa - so a jwt_token is returned. This is most likely aliased to /api/v2/token API end point.

This calls `PgGetUser` and that will call the stored procedure `c_login_user` to acces the database info on this user.

func HandleLogin

func HandleLogin(www http.ResponseWriter, req *http.Request)

HandleLogin is a login handler. It checks the username/password and if the hashed password matches then success is achieved. If 2FA is enabled then this will not return a jwt_token. The 2fa device must be activated before the token is returned.

This calls `PgGetUser` and that will call the stored procedure `c_login_user` to acces the database info on this user.

func HandleRegisterTokenUser

func HandleRegisterTokenUser(www http.ResponseWriter, req *http.Request)

HandleRegisterTokenUser

Description: Create an account that logins with a single token. The only identificaiton for the account is the token. The token should be kept secret - it is the password.

Request Inputs:

user_id is form the login/authenciation JWT token and can not be passed in.
app_name is a user specificad application name string - it serves to identify the account but is not used in the login process to the account.
